Weekday Pairs Game

Students ask what day it is to find their matching day of the week. For Let's Try Unit 3.

Kids love the pairs finding game, so I made one to practice saying the days of the week.

How to play:
- Give each student 1 card (the card is a secret to others!)
- In pairs, one student will ask "What day is it?"
- In response, the other student will say the day on their card.
- If they have the same day, they sit on the floor where they are and wait for the others to finish.
- If they have different days, they keep searching.

Once all the students have found their pairs and are sitting, it's time for part 2:
-Have students arrange themselves in order according to their weekdays using ONLY ENGLISH

This game is designed for small classes, but you can scale it up by having students search for 3 or 4 people with the same day. If you have fewer than 14 students, you can play multiple times to make sure you get all the days in. (You can also just play multiple times because the kids usually want to.)

Weekday cards are made with the textbook food images. They make no sense, but putting themselves in order would be too easy if I used the usual elements.

The powerpoint is just for displaying the target dialog. The game is best explained with a demonstration with your JTE.
